The captivating print titled "Orpheus in the Underworld reclaiming Eurydice, or The Music" by Jean II Restout takes us on a journey through ancient Greek mythology. This masterpiece, measuring 355x575 cm, can be found at the Louvre in Paris, France. In this scene, we witness Orpheus descending into the depths of Hades to plead for the return of his beloved Eurydice. With his lyre in hand and surrounded by mythical figures such as Pluto and Persephone, Orpheus uses the power of music to move even the judges of death themselves. Restout's attention to detail is truly remarkable; every brushstroke brings life to each character depicted. The intensity of emotion is palpable as Orpheus desperately tries to win back his lost love from the clutches of death.
